SPACE TOURISM
- INDUSTRY: Relatively new and the participants in this industry have pledged to take ordinary people up to space using their technology and spaceships.
- MARKET PLAYERS: Virgin Galactic (Richard Branson), Blue Origin (Jeff Bezos) and SpaceX (Elon Musk) are the most prominent companies which are expected to take tourists in space already in 2023.
- MARKET POTENTIAL: AN INCREASE OF 506% COULD BE EXPECTED UNTIL 2031. According to BIS Research, in 2020, the size of the Sub-Orbital and Space Tourism market was $428.8 million. It could be expected to rise to nearly $2.6 billion by 2031, which represents a Compounded Annual Growth Rate of 17.15%.
VIRGIN GALACTIC
- THE COMPANY: Virgin Galactic is developing space vehicles and building a commercial space tourism service to take private citizens into space. Virgin Galactic Holdings serves customers in the United States. Virgin Galactic is the largest publicly traded space tourism company on the market.
- GROWTH POTENTIAL: AN INCREASE FROM $3.292 MILLION TO $1.7 BILLION BY 2030. The company could be expected to grow its revenue by 2025 from $3.292 million to $219 million.
VIRGIN GALACTIC: EVENTS AND ANALYSIS
- EVENT (END OF JUNE 2023: FIRST COMMERCIAL FLIGHT): Virgin Galactic is expected to conduct its first commercial flight in late June carrying the Italian Air Force to space as part of the “Galactic 01” mission. After that, if everything goes according to plan, more flights should be conducted by the end of 2023.
- SUCCESSFUL TEST FLIGHT: MAY 25. Virgin Galactic’s aircraft, VMS Eve, departed the New Mexico launch site carrying a crew of six (plus two aircraft pilots). The VSS Unity spaceplane dropped from the wing of the jet a little over an hour later. The entire mission lasted around 90 minutes.
